A
paper
(22 pages) on Dr.
James C. Waynt's website.
He is Dean of the College of Optical Sciences at the University of
Arizona. This paper has a short discussion of Zernike phase
contrast, FECO interferometer, Nomarski reflected light microscope,
and Francon Interference Eyepiece. It also describes the use of
Mirau, Linnnik & Michelson Interferometers for examining surface
quality. Dr. Waynt has done a great deal of work with interferometry
and his papers, many of which are available on his website, might be
of interest to some of you. Once again Physics is showing the way to
Open Access Publishing by retaining copyright to the papers they
publish so they can make them available to others.
The UN Food Agriculture Organization FAO page on Veterinary Diagnostic Parasitology gives a step by step method for finding parasites, their eggs and cysts in fecal material. It is mostly written for cattle but worms are worms and the same principles apply across all species. It is set up for small laboratory's in the third world and is suited for most amateurs. 1/7/07

Mark
Simmons owns Perspective
Image and make eyepieces/relay lenses for microscopes that
adapt most digital and film cameras to microscopes quite easily. He
has optics for compensating and non-compensating objectives listing
Leitz Periplan and Zeiss Kpl optics as well as his own designs. A
sleeper is his Modular
Microscope Objective
Holder that is short
tube microscope that works well as macro attachment in the field
for a digital camera. I have 2 of his eyepieces and they work very
well. I have the ability to use any eyepiece I please with any
camera I have and I seldom use any eyepiece but Marks because they
are so easy to use. A Zeiss Kpl Pol eyepiece will have less
chromatic aberration than Mark's with Zeiss Pol and Pol Plan
objectives. But unless I am taking a picture of something like a
stage micrometer that has sharp lines and passes both red and blue
light it is hard to see.
Mark also does some custom machine shop
work for microscopist.
